Fertilizing is basic to supporting plant health and achieving lavish, dynamic landscapes. Plants require a balanced supply of nutrients-- primarily n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ium-- to grow strong roots, produce abundant flowers, and keep dynamic foliage. A soil test is the initial step in identifying what nutrients are lacking, guaranteeing that the picked fertilizer fulfills the specific needs of the site. Fertilizers come in different kinds, including granular, liquid, natural, and synthetic, each offering various release rates and benefits. Using the ideal type at the right time is essential to avoid nutrient runoff, root burn, or unequal development. Seasonal timing, such as using greater nitrogen in the spring and more potassium in the fall, helps plants get ready for growth spurts or hold up against winter season stress. Constant fertilization not just enhances plant look however likewise enhances durability versus insects, diseases, and ecological stressors. A well-fed landscape is more likely to prosper year after year, providing both beauty and ecological value
